Cloud Crusader is a white Human Knight creature card from the 2010 Magic: The Gathering M11 core set, featuring the keywords flying and first strike.

Released in 2010, the Cloud Crusader card serves as a foundational white mana source within the Magic: The Gathering M11 core set. Identified as card number 10, this Common rarity piece introduces collectors to the strategic depth of the game’s early modern era. The card depicts a Human Knight wielding first strike, allowing it to deal combat damage before opponents without the ability, while its flying keyword grants it aerial mobility against ground-based blockers. Designed by Aleksi Briclot, the Cloud Crusader represents the quintessential archetype of the M11 redesign era, which brought clarity and modern aesthetics to the brand. Collectors often seek this card to complete their M11 base set runs or to understand the mechanical evolution of white aggression in Magic: The Gathering. Its straightforward mana cost and reliable abilities make it a recognizable artifact for enthusiasts studying the game's history.
